1.CPU=运算器+控制器。
2.控制器的功能:指令控制、操作控制、时间控制、数据加工、中断处理。
3.CPU中的主要寄存器:
数据缓冲寄存器(DR)、指令寄存器(IR)、程序寄存器(PC)、地址寄存器(AR)、累加寄存器(ACC)、状态条件寄存器(PSW)。
4.指令的执行过程与信息流:
取指周期信息流:
PC>>MAR
1>>R
M(MAR)>>MDR
(MDR)>>IR
OP(IR)>>CU
(PC)+1>>PC
间接周期信息流:
AD(IR)>>MAR
1>>R
M(MAR)>>MDR
5.微指令的基本格式:操作控制+顺序控制。
6.微命令和微操作有什么关系?
控制部件向执行部件发出的各种控制命令叫微命令。
微操作是微命令的操作过程,微命令是微操作的控制信号。
7.数据相关:写后读相关,读后写相关,写后写相关。
8.中断向量是中断服务程序的入口地址,中断向量地址是中断服务程序入口地址的地址。
相关文章
- 10-26spark1.3.x与spark2.x启动executor不同的cpu core分配方式
- 10-26CPU tick counter
- 10-26判断机器CPU的大小端模式并将数据转换成小端形式
- 10-26使用top可视化查看cpu usage
- 10-26window锁屏后,总是风扇狂转,抓出偷用cpu的凶手!
- 10-26Tensorflow框架无法调用GPU而使用CPU计算的解决方法
- 10-26虚拟机vcpu绑定物理cpu命令virsh
- 10-26cpu为什么使用虚拟地址到物理地址的空间映射,解决了什么样的问题?
- 10-26Kafka-python 客户端导致的 cpu 使用过高,且无法消费消息的问题
- 10-26Web应用cpu过高